Wesley Ngetich Kimutai
Wesley Ngetich Kimutai (born 15 December 1977 † 21 January 2008 at Trans Mara District ) was a Kenyan marathon runner.
2005 and 2007 he won the Grandma's Marathon in Duluth. In 2006 he presented as the Second Houston Marathon with 2:12:06 h his personal best.
In the wake of the unrest in Kenya 2007/2008 he died of a poisoned arrow that struck him in the chest. Previously, the Olympian Lucas Sang already had become a victim of violence.
Kimutai was married and had three children.
